Indeed. I believe what'll be required is whoever uses your maps will need Uziis mods and then you make your maps as you would in forge (default terran or whatever). You'll manually need ot go into it via texteditor and change planet types to ocean/forest etc for the relevant planets. If you make the maps I wouldnt mind helping go through and altering the mapfile via txt.
